An amateur star, Pat O’Connor transitioned with ease to the professional ranks and worked his way up the ladder to become the NWA World Heavyweight Champion in 1959, holding it for two years. O’Connor was not the most charismatic individual, but he was so fluid in the ring that thousands of fans paid to see him compete. Although he lost the World Strap in 1961, O’Connor would compete for twenty more years after putting on clinics across the United States.
